Abstract

This invention pertains to a curable composition comprising a first component having beta-ketoacetate and/or malonate functionalities and a second component having two or more aldehyde functionalities. The compositions can be cured at room temperature or low temperatures to yield crosslinked networks that are capable of providing desirable properties for coating and adhesive applications. The reactive functionalities of beta-ketoacetate, malonate, and aldehyde can be either on polymers as the main binders or on small molecules as the crosslinkers. The curable compositions desirably are either solventless or organic solvent based.
